    Quote Originally Posted by Oh, that's raspberry! View Post
    I hoped to watch this but I got too distracted during it to really notice much except Herzog at the end, but I have a question or two. Was the Ricky Spanish character already seen/mentioned in an earlier episode, and is it supposed to be a parody of something?
    Ricky Spanish was a partial spoof on "My Name is Earl" which had the same premise of a former ner' do well who makes a list of people he wronged and makes up for it.
